Step 6 — Releasing the QueueTide autoscaler

Before promoting the QueueTide build to production, confirm that the scaling thresholds in the manifest match the values agreed at last week's capacity review. The release pipeline verifies every artifact against the current deploy key, and mismatches will halt the rollout at the gate stage. As discussed in the sync, each engineer pushing a release must register the signer locally. Configure your signing tool with the key below.

release key, hadug-kawef: bky13_mPGeFZeR1GZ1G

Hi Tamsin, welcome aboard! Quick heads-up before your first Dovetail shift: we've got a known bug where session tokens sometimes fail to refresh after midnight rollover, and users get bounced to login. It's annoying but harmless — there's a workaround script and you shouldn't page anyone for it. Everything you need, including the script, is on the page below.

dashboard of yahaf-kajep = https://jira.zemvarsys.internal/display/projects/browse/browse/a08b

Hey Marit — handing off the Fernwick gateway work before I'm out. Short version: permessage-deflate on the websocket layer saves us ~60% bandwidth on the telemetry stream, but the per-connection zlib contexts chew memory fast above 10k clients. I capped the window bits and disabled context takeover, which felt like the right middle ground. Benchmarks are in the repo under /perf. Please sanity-check my numbers. Here are the current settings we're running in staging:

config for hahaf-kafof:
[wenys]
host = wenys.torvahq.corp
user = wenys_svc
database = wenys_prod

**Mgmt Meeting Minutes — Retiring the Brightline Range**

Quick recap for sales leads at Fenholt Supplies: we agreed to retire the Brightline fixture range by year-end. Remaining stock moves to clearance pricing next month, and accounts on standing orders get migrated to the Lumetta range. Trade-in incentives were approved in principle. The confidential note on next steps sits just below.

board note of bajof-bajeg: The pricing group signed off on a budget of $13.4 million for Project Sildor. The renewal with Lamixek Holdings closes at $48.9 million a year, 49 percent above the last contract.